Product Detailed Parameters

  • Description:IC MCU 32BIT 1MB FLASH 100TQFP
  • Series:SAM E51
  • Mfr:Microchip Technology
  • Package:Tape & Reel (TR),Cut Tape (CT)
  • Core Processor:ARM® Cortex®-M4F
  • Core Size:32-Bit Single-Core
  • Speed:120MHz
  • Connectivity:CANbus, EBI/EMI, I2C, IrDA, LINbus, MMC/SD, QSPI, SPI, UART/USART, USB
  • Peripherals:Brown-out Detect/Reset, DMA, I2S, POR, PWM
  • Number of I/O:81
  • Program Memory Size:1MB (1M x 8)
  • Program Memory Type:FLASH
  • EEPROM Size:-
  • RAM Size:256K x 8
  • Voltage - Supply (Vcc/Vdd):1.71V ~ 3.63V
  • Data Converters:A/D 28x12b; D/A 2x12b
  • Oscillator Type:Internal
  • Operating Temperature:-40°C ~ 85°C (TA)
  • Mounting Type:Surface Mount
  • Supplier Device Package:100-TQFP (14x14)
  • Package / Case:100-TQFP
  • Grade:-
  • Qualification:-

Overview

The ATSAME51N20A-AUT is a 32-bit microcontroller from the SAM E51 family, manufactured by Microchip Technology. It features an ARM Cortex-M4F core operating at a maximum frequency of 120 MHz. The device integrates 1 MB of in-system programmable flash memory and 256 KB of SRAM. It supports a supply voltage range of 1.71 V to 3.63 V and operates within a temperature range of -40°C to +85°C. The component is housed in a 100-TQFP package with 81 I/O lines.
